Biography

11/25/1937 - 02/17/2015


GLEESON, Francis E., Jr., a Representative from Philadelphia County; born in Philadelphia, Philadelphia County, Pa., November 25, 1937; graduated, La Salle High School; A.B., La Salle College, 1959; LL.B., University of Pennsylvania Law School, 1962; served, United States Army Reserve (1962-1968); attorney; elected as a Democrat to the Pennsylvania House of Representatives for the 1969 term and served 4 more consecutive terms; unsuccessful campaign for reelection to the House for the 1979 term; stand-up comedian; died, February 17, 2015 in Philadelphia, Philadelphia County, Pennsylvania; interred, St. Dominic Cemetery, Philadelphia, Philadelphia County, Pennsylvania.
